Albert Venter is a South African political risk analyst and academic, known for his research on migration, governance, and socio-economic issues in South Africa. His work often highlights the complex interplay between immigration policies and their socio-political implications, particularly in relation to the challenges posed by undocumented migration and its impact on public services and national security.
